Are you a budding romance writer? Then learn from an expert. Kate Walker writes modern romance for women and sells internationally. Here, she explains her approach to writing novels that keeps the reader gripped and holds them with that vital page turning quality. You can use all of the hooks you want to, but if your story does not have heart, it simply will not sell. This book will explain: The 3 most important components to make a romance novel a bestseller; The connection between reading a romance & a good sexual experience; How you involve your reader with the hero and heroine in your novel; The two types of personal conflict and how to deal with them; The 4 components of great dialogue; The 4 aspects of character focus; The two purposes behind the development of sensuality in your novel; The before & after events you must include when writing passion scenes; The importance of your hero; How to write the 3 aspects of his character; The importance of the heroine; How to answer the question 'why?'; How to write the intense black moment; Write believable happy endings Non sono state trovate descrizioni di biblioteche |
